zinc finger protein with KRAB & SCAN domains 1; zinc finger protein 36; zinc finger protein KOX18 (ZKSCAN1, KOX18, ZNF139, ZNF36)
Function:
- may be involved in transcriptional regulation
- phosphorylated upon DNA damage, probably by ATM or ATR
Structure:
- belongs to the krueppel C2H2-type Zn+2-finger protein family
- contains 6 C2H2-type Zn+2 fingers
- contains 1 KRAB domain
- contains 1 SCAN box domain
Compartment: nucleus (putative)
